Understanding Retaining Walls

A retaining wall is a structure that holds back soil or rock from a property. It is usually made of concrete, stone, or brick. Retaining walls are commonly used to prevent erosion and create level areas in sloped landscapes. They can also be used for decorative purposes.

When choosing a retaining wall, it’s important to consider the following:

Purpose

Do you need a retaining wall for functional purposes, such as preventing erosion or creating level areas? Or do you want a retaining wall for decorative purposes?

Material

The most common materials for retaining walls are concrete, stone, and brick. Each material has its benefits and drawbacks. For example, concrete is very durable but can be expensive. Stone is a natural material that looks great but can be difficult to install. Brick is a classic material that is easy to work with but may not be as strong as concrete or stone.

Height

The height of the retaining wall will determine how much soil or rock it can hold back. Taller retaining walls are more expensive but can provide more stability.

Slope

The slope of the retaining wall will affect how much water it can hold back. A retaining wall with a steeper slope can provide more stability but may be more expensive.

Retaining Wall Construction Process

The construction process for a retaining wall varies depending on the material. For example, a concrete retaining wall is typically poured into place, while a stone retaining wall is built by stacking stones on top of each other.

The following is a general overview of the construction process for a retaining wall:

  1. Excavate the area where the retaining wall will be built. This includes removing any vegetation or debris from the site.
  2. Create a level foundation for the retaining wall. This may involve compacting the soil or adding gravel to the area.
  3. Install drainage behind the retaining wall to prevent water from seeping through. This may involve installing perforated pipe or using a fabric drain liner.
  4. Build the retaining wall according to your chosen design. This may include stacking stones or pouring concrete into place.
  5. Finish the retaining wall by adding a layer of soil or gravel on top of it. This will help to prevent erosion.
